启动appium服务的2种方法(python脚本&cmd窗口)

1.通过cmd窗口命令来启动

2.通过python代码启动

2.1启动单个appium服务

2.2启动多个appium服务

3.端口说明

一.端口号设置
Appium服务器端口:4723 bp端口:4724
Appium服务器端口:4725 bp端口:4726

可以看到appium服务器端口和bp端口是相差一位的

什么是bp端口?
bp端口就是bootstrap port,是appium和手机之间的通讯端口,

如果不能指定到,则无法运行多台设备

二.脚本命令写法

在cmd窗口,我们运行设备,是appium -a host -p 端口号 -bp 端口号

那么我们写在python脚本就是一样的,只不过参数化而已
/b 是指不打开cmd弹窗运行'

三.输入到日志

stdout=open('./appium_log/'+str(port)+'.log','a')

启动校验

3.1 通过cmd命令查看

3.1.1查看指定端口号

netstat -ano | findstr 端口号

3.1.2 查看全部端口号

netstat -ano

3.2 通过生成的log文件查看

直接在生成的log文件中,查看即可

3.2.1生成的log文件

3.2.2log文件的内容

相关推荐
Hi~晴天大圣1 天前
Appium环境搭建
appium
川石课堂软件测试2 天前
什么是埋点测试,app埋点测试怎么做?
功能测试·测试工具·华为·小程序·单元测试·appium·harmonyos
川石课堂软件测试7 天前
使用mock进行接口测试教程
数据库·python·功能测试·测试工具·华为·单元测试·appium
aovenus8 天前
使用Midscene.js和Appium开展移动应用自动化的对比
appium·midscene.js
one day3218 天前
appium
appium
测试开发-学习笔记9 天前
从0开始搭建app的自动化(二)-appium+python
python·appium·自动化
测试员周周14 天前
【Appium 系列】第18节-重试与容错 — 移动端测试的稳定性保障
人工智能·python·功能测试·ui·单元测试·appium·测试用例
测试员周周14 天前
【Appium 系列】第17节-XMind用例转换 — 从思维导图到 YAML
java·服务器·人工智能·单元测试·appium·测试用例·xmind
测试员周周14 天前
【Appium 系列】第20节-测试项目结构设计 — 从脚本到工程
人工智能·数据挖掘·回归·单元测试·appium·测试用例·测试覆盖率
测试员周周15 天前
【Appium 系列】第14节-断言与验证 — Validator 的设计
android·人工智能·python·功能测试·ios·单元测试·appium